The A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ner is an entry-level certification offered by Amazon Web Services that validates a person's overall understanding of the AWS Cloud, its basic global infrastructure, pricing models, security concepts, and core services. It is designed for individuals seeking to demonstrate foundational cloud knowledge applicable to a variety of roles within cloud environments.
Key Features
- Provides a solid foundational understanding of AWS Cloud concepts
- Covers key services such as compute, storage, databases, and networking
- Emphasizes cloud security and compliance fundamentals
- Prepares candidates for more advanced AWS certifications
- Accessible to individuals with no prior cloud experience
